Pic Of the Day: Modi Did It, What About You!

India is on the electoral phase currently and the polls are underway for the parliament constituencies in a phased manner. Today, Prime Minister Narendra Modi casted his vote in Ahmedabad during the third phase of the elections. This time, the polls are being carried out in seven phases.

Taking to his X profile, Narendra Modi displayed his inked finger after voting at a polling booth in Ahmedabad’s Nishan Higher Secondary School.

Speaking outside the polling booth, Modi said, “Today is the third phase of voting. There is great importance of ‘Daan‘ in our country and in the same spirit, the countrymen should vote as much as possible. 4 rounds of voting are still ahead.”

“Voted in the 2024 Lok Sabha elections! Urging everyone to do so as well and strengthen our democracy.” wrote Narendra Modi, encouraging everyone to take part in the voting on X profile.

On Tuesday, the voting is underway in 94 constituencies across 10 states and 1 Union territory in the third phase of the 18th Lok Sabha elections.
